A Secret Weapon For what is md5's application

The vulnerabilities of MD5, including susceptibility to collision and pre-graphic assaults, have triggered authentic-entire world safety breaches and demonstrated the urgent will need for safer alternatives.

Whilst MD5 and SHA may be used with salts, they do not include things like crucial stretching, which happens to be a essential feature for securely hashing passwords. Essential stretching increases the computational hard work required to compute the hash, which makes it harder for attackers to crack passwords through brute drive.

In case you are continue to puzzled by how these calculations get the job done, Maybe it’s a smart idea to look into the modular arithmetic hyperlink posted earlier mentioned. Another option is to convert the hexadecimal quantities into decimal quantities.

It can still Present you with an notion of how this new G function operates, and help save you from scrolling through webpages of repetition. Permit’s say which the 16th operation brought about the subsequent initialization vectors for your 17th round:

Which means that our enter, M, can be an input in Each and every of those 4 levels. However, just before it may be used being an enter, our 512-little bit M needs to be split into sixteen 32-bit “terms”. Just about every of such words is assigned its personal amount, ranging from M0 to M15. Within our illustration, these sixteen text are:

Pre-graphic attacks goal to seek out an enter that matches a supplied hash benefit. Specified an MD5 hash, an attacker can employ various techniques, such as brute force or rainbow tables, to locate an input that hashes towards the goal value.

This short article handles the mechanics on the MD5 algorithm in detail. It’s our next and last piece over the MD5 hash operate, that is an older and insecure algorithm that turns knowledge of random lengths into set 128-bit hashes. Our What is MD5? short article focused on MD5’s:

MD5 is usually a widely used hash functionality producing a 128-little bit hash, but has recognised collision vulnerabilities rendering it unsuitable for encryption usage. It remains common for integrity examining in non-protection contexts.

While fewer popular today due to security issues, MD5 was as soon as extensively used in the creation of digital signatures. The hash of the data would be encrypted with a private key to deliver the electronic signature, as well as receiver would confirm it utilizing a community crucial.

Isolate or Substitute: If possible, isolate legacy check here systems from the broader community to reduce exposure. Plan with the gradual substitution or update of these systems with safer authentication approaches.

These attacks exploit the fact that lots of people decide on predictable passwords, and MD5’s pace makes it much easier to compute and keep huge rainbow tables.

Therefore, reaction occasions could possibly be delayed, and Are living chat will likely be quickly unavailable. We appreciate your knowing and tolerance throughout this time. Remember to Be happy to email us, and we will get back again for you as soon as possible.

Consequently, more recent hash capabilities for example SHA-256 are frequently advisable for more secure applications.

The MD5 algorithm has become generally applied to check files integrity following a transfer. With substantial documents Specifically, you’ll frequently look for a MD5 file to the obtain web page, allowing you to examine In case the download is complete and legitimate.

Leave a Reply

Your email address will not be published. Required fields are marked *